As the first quarter of 2025 comes to a close, Hedera (HBAR) has navigated a complex landscape of technological advancements, strategic partnerships, and market fluctuations. The year began with significant organizational changes, including a leadership transition and the launch of a Hedera HBAR Exchange Traded Product (ETP) on Euronext Amsterdam, enhancing European investor access to HBAR. Moreover, Hedera’s ecosystem has seen notable partnerships, including collaborations with EQTYLab, NVIDIA, and Intel on a Verifiable Compute solution, which records AI computations on the Hedera network. Additionally, Hedera has strengthened its ecosystem through integrations with Chainlink’s Data Feeds and Proof of Reserve systems, as well as a partnership with SEALSQ Corp for quantum-resistant semiconductors. These developments position Hedera for potential expansion and growth in 2025.

Technological Developments
- Public Beta Test: A significant development in Q1 2025 was the launch of a public beta test for the Hedera Hashgraph network, which boasts a throughput of 10,000 transactions per second. This technological advancement positions Hedera as a competitive player in the blockchain space.
- Applications and Ecosystem Growth: With over three dozen applications already operating on the Hedera network, the ecosystem continues to expand, offering promising use cases for HBAR. Notable additions include Bonzo Finance, a lending protocol with over $22 million in Total Value Locked, and MemeJobFun, which introduces new DeFi possibilities through meme-based Web3 interactions.

New Partnerships and Developments
- Chainlink Integration: Hedera’s integration with Chainlink’s Data Feeds and Proof of Reserve systems represents a significant technological advancement, potentially attracting more DeFi developers to the ecosystem.
- SEALSQ Partnership: The partnership with SEALSQ Corp for quantum-resistant semiconductors positions Hedera at the forefront of blockchain security innovation, with the QS7001 hardware platform scheduled for 2025.
- EQTYLab, NVIDIA, and Intel Collaboration: The Verifiable Compute solution with these partners enhances governance and audit capabilities, further solidifying Hedera’s position in the blockchain space.
